@@ -0,0 +1,97 @@
using System.Diagnostics;
using JdeScoping.ConfigManager.Models;
using Microsoft.Data.SqlClient;
namespace JdeScoping.ConfigManager.Services;
/// <summary>
/// Service for testing database connections.
/// </summary>
public class ConnectionTestService : IConnectionTestService
{
private const int ConnectionTimeoutSeconds = 10;
public async Task<ConnectionTestResult> TestConnectionAsync(
string connectionString,
ConnectionProvider provider,
CancellationToken cancellationToken = default)
{
return provider switch
{
ConnectionProvider.SqlServer => await TestSqlServerConnectionAsync(connectionString, cancellationToken).ConfigureAwait(false),
ConnectionProvider.Oracle => new ConnectionTestResult
{
Success = false,
Message = "Oracle connection testing not implemented"
},
ConnectionProvider.Generic => new ConnectionTestResult
{
Success = false,
Message = "Cannot test generic connection strings"
},
_ => new ConnectionTestResult
{
Success = false,
Message = $"Unknown provider: {provider}"
}
};
}
private static async Task<ConnectionTestResult> TestSqlServerConnectionAsync(
string connectionString,
CancellationToken cancellationToken)
{
var stopwatch = Stopwatch.StartNew();
try
{
// Ensure connection timeout is set
var builder = new SqlConnectionStringBuilder(connectionString)
{
ConnectTimeout = ConnectionTimeoutSeconds
};
await using var connection = new SqlConnection(builder.ConnectionString);
await connection.OpenAsync(cancellationToken).ConfigureAwait(false);
stopwatch.Stop();
return new ConnectionTestResult
{
Success = true,
Message = "Connection successful",
Duration = stopwatch.Elapsed
};
}
catch (OperationCanceledException)
{
stopwatch.Stop();
return new ConnectionTestResult
{
Success = false,
Message = "Connection test was cancelled",
Duration = stopwatch.Elapsed
};
}
catch (SqlException ex)
{
stopwatch.Stop();
return new ConnectionTestResult
{
Success = false,
Message = $"SQL Server error: {ex.Message}",
Duration = stopwatch.Elapsed
};
}
catch (Exception ex)
{
stopwatch.Stop();
return new ConnectionTestResult
{
Success = false,
Message = $"Connection failed: {ex.Message}",
Duration = stopwatch.Elapsed
};
}
}
}

# ConnectionStrings Editor - Design Plan
## Overview
Add a ConnectionStrings section under Settings in the ConfigManager tree view. This section provides a master-detail editor for managing database connection strings with provider-specific field editing.
## Design Decisions
| Decision | Choice | Rationale |
|----------|--------|-----------|
| Storage location | appsettings.json | Consistent with existing settings pattern |
| Field editing | Provider-specific parsed fields | Better UX than raw connection string editing |
| Supported providers | Generic, Oracle, SqlServer | Covers existing JDE/CMS/MSSQL needs |
| SQL Server auth | SQL Authentication only | Windows auth not needed for this use case |
| Password display | Masked with reveal toggle | Security + usability balance |
| Edit workflow | Inline panel editing | Matches existing form patterns |
| Delete behavior | Confirmation dialog, immediate | Prevents accidents, clear feedback |

### Connection String Formats
**SqlServer:**
```
Server={server};Database={database};User Id={userId};Password={password};Encrypt={encrypt};TrustServerCertificate={trust};Connection Timeout={timeout};Application Name={appName};
```
**Oracle (EZConnect):**
```
Data Source=//{host}:{port}/{serviceName};User Id={userId};Password={password};Connection Timeout={timeout};
```
**Generic:**
Raw connection string as entered by user.
